免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12下一页
最近访问板块 发新帖
查看: 2141 | 回复: 14
打印 上一主题 下一主题

[Mail] 请教qmail-scanner+clamav不能拦截病毒邮件的问题 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2004-11-04 10:36 |只看该作者 |倒序浏览
.contrib/test_installation.sh -doit 测试正常,我的postmaster@domain.com能收到四封提示邮件。
但是我撰写并发送病毒邮件就不能检查出来。
病毒放在机器上用clamav能查出来的。
请教高手 ,是不是小弟还有哪儿设置忽略了?

论坛徽章:
0
2 [报告]
发表于 2004-11-04 16:24 |只看该作者

请教qmail-scanner+clamav不能拦截病毒邮件的问题

在本地发送邮件前
请先确认环境变量QMAILQUEUE是否为/var/qmail/bin/qmail-scanner-queue.pl

--
fireheike 该用户已被删除
3 [报告]
发表于 2004-11-04 16:39 |只看该作者
提示: 作者被禁止或删除 内容自动屏蔽

论坛徽章:
0
4 [报告]
发表于 2004-11-04 21:22 |只看该作者

请教qmail-scanner+clamav不能拦截病毒邮件的问题

在最后发现还是环境有问题,最后放弃了在启动文件中加入参数,还是选择了修改smtp规则文件。好了。

论坛徽章:
0
5 [报告]
发表于 2005-12-03 12:05 |只看该作者
我也碰到这样的问题,大哥怎么处理的能贴出来吗

论坛徽章:
0
6 [报告]
发表于 2005-12-03 15:41 |只看该作者
还没想通测试四封信为社么可以通过的
哪位大哥知道测试这四封信的过程是怎么样的,是模拟smtp向邮箱发信的还是直接就掉用clamav来删的
谢谢

论坛徽章:
0
7 [报告]
发表于 2005-12-03 17:01 |只看该作者

哪位大哥看一下,我觉得我的脚本好像有问题

我觉得是不是我的脚本有问题

#!/bin/sh
QMAILDUID=`id -u vpopmail`
NOFILESGID=`id -g vpopmail`
MAXSMTPD=`cat /var/qmail/control/concurrencyincoming`
exec /usr/local/bin/softlimit -m 8000000 \
    /usr/local/bin/tcpserver -v -H -R -l 0 \
    -x /home/vpopmail/etc/tcp.smtp.cdb -c "$MAXSMTPD" \
    -u "$QMAILDUID" -g "$NOFILESGID" 0 smtp \
    /var/qmail/bin/qmail-smtpd \
    /home/vpopmail/bin/vchkpw /bin/true 2>&1
QMAILQUEUE=/var/qmail/bin/qmail-scanner-queue.pl
export QMAILQUEUE
帮忙看一下~~~谢谢

论坛徽章:
0
8 [报告]
发表于 2005-12-03 17:09 |只看该作者

回复 5楼 mxli 的帖子

看看你的clamd的配置有什么问题没有呢??还有你的qs的编译的参数等等~

论坛徽章:
0
9 [报告]
发表于 2005-12-03 22:59 |只看该作者
# vi /var/qmail/supervise/qmail-smtpd/run
#!/bin/sh
QMAILDUID=`id -u vpopmail`
NOFILESGID=`id -g vpopmail`
QMAILQUEUE=`var/qmail/bin/qmail-scanner-queue.pl` export QMAILQUEUE
MAXSMTPD=`cat /var/qmail/control/concurrencyincoming`
exec /usr/local/bin/softlimit -m 40000000 \
    /usr/local/bin/tcpserver -v -H -R -l 0 \
    -x /home/vpopmail/etc/tcp.smtp.cdb -c "$MAXSMTPD" \
    -u "$QMAILDUID" -g "$NOFILESGID" 0 smtp \
    /var/qmail/bin/qmail-smtpd \
    /home/vpopmail/bin/vchkpw /bin/true 2>&1

# vi /home/vpopmail/etc/tcp.smtp
127.0.0.1:allow,RELAYCLIENT="",QMAILQUEUE="/var/qmail/bin/qmail-queue"
:allow,QMAILQUEUE="/var/qmail/bin/qmail-scanner-queue.pl"
# cd /home/vpopmail/etc; tcprules tcp.smtp.cdb tcp.smtp.tmp<tcp.smtp
# qmailctl stop; qmailctl start

[ 本帖最后由 红雨 于 2005-12-3 23:01 编辑 ]

论坛徽章:
0
10 [报告]
发表于 2005-12-05 10:43 |只看该作者
谢谢大哥,我试一把~~
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P